Ingredients Jump to Instructions ↓

  1. 1 1/2 to 2 pounds halibut fillets

  2. 1 tablespoon melted butter

  3. salt and pepper

  4. 2 tablespoons butter

  5. 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our

  6. 1 cup whole milk

  7. 1 egg yolk

  8. 2 tablespoons fresh Parmesan cheese

  9. 2 to 3 teaspoons grainy mustard or Creole mustard, or to taste

  10. sal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ste

Instructions Jump to Ingredients ↑

  1. Lightly butter a baking dish large enough to hold halibut in one layer. Heat oven to 375. Arrange halibut in the dish, brush with the 1 tablespoon of melted butter, and sprinkle lightly with salt and pepper. Bake the halibut fillets for 20 to 25 minutes, or until cooked through.

  2. Meanwhile, in a saucepan over medium-low heat, melt butter. Add green onion and cook for 1 minute. Stir in flour until well blended. Gradually stir in milk. Cook, stirringConstantly, until slightly thickened. In a small bowl or cup, whisk the egg yolk; stir in a few tablespoons of the hot mixture, blending well. Add the mixture back to the saucepan; stir in Parmesan cheese and continue cooking until smooth. Taste and add mustard, salt, and pepper, as desired.

  3. Serve halibut fillets with the creamy sauce.

  4. Serves 4.
